DANCE


Ballet Folklórico Mexicano de Yale 

Presenters:

Yale student dancers

Join us in an interactive session! Dancers from Ballet Folklórico Mexicano de Yale will introduce and teach everyone how to do a grito (a type of celebratory yell done by the dancers as a way to express enjoyment). Additionally, the dancers will teach the audience 2 fun steps (i.e. Café con Pan and Sopa de Pato). To end the interactive component, the dancers will ask participants to join the dancers on stage for a freestyle dance. The session will conclude with dance performances from the region of Jalisco, Mexico. Jaír will perform "El Gusto", a popular, fast-paced Mariachi song that is a staple of the region. Carmen, Marcos, Karla, and Levi will end with "Jarabe Tapatío", the national dance of Mexico.
